Who We Are

The Public Company Accounting Oversight Board (PCAOB), a nonprofit organization established by Congress, oversees the audits of public companies and SEC-registered brokers and dealers to protect investors and to further the public interest in the preparation of independent, accurate, and informative audit reports.

Our investor protection mission is focused on modernizing audit standards, enhancing audit inspections, and strengthening enforcement of PCAOB rules and standards and other related laws and rules. People are at the heart of our mission at the PCAOB.  As we carry out that mission, we strive to uphold the highest standards in audit quality with investors’ families, savings, and futures in mind.

Role Summary

The PCAOB has an intern position in the Office of Communications and Engagement. This intern will work with the Communications and Engagement team on stakeholder engagement projects that inform and educate the public about the oversight of auditors of public companies and broker-dealers. Intern will have exposure to all facets of communications and outreach work in a regulatory setting.

Responsibilities

  • Assist with the release of key announcements

  • Assist in the preparation of key materials to support the PCAOB mission

  • Support external stakeholder engagement activities including Scholars Program, Advisory Groups and other programs and events

  • Write and edit materials to ensure that complex auditing concepts and issues are explained in plain English for general readers and the media

  • Conduct research and analysis of auditing issues and press reports

  • Draft and update Board communication materials and databases, requiring strong organizational skills and attention to detail

Qualifications

  • Undergraduate (junior or senior level) or graduate student, studying communications, public relations, public administration, or related disciplines

  • Excellent writing and proofreading skills

  • Proficient in Microsoft Office and Outlook applications including PowerPoint and Excel

  • Must be reliable and self-motivated with strong attention to detail

  • Must be organized and able to meet deadlines

  • Must work as a team member

  • Must be flexible and solve problems independently

  •  Must be legally authorized to work in the United States without the need for employer sponsorship, now or at any time in the future.

What you need to know about the Chicago Tech Scene

With vibrant neighborhoods, great food and more affordable housing than either coast, Chicago might be the most liveable major tech hub. It is the birthplace of modern commodities and futures trading, a national hub for logistics and commerce, and home to the American Medical Association and the American Bar Association. This diverse blend of industry influences has helped Chicago emerge as a major player in verticals like fintech, biotechnology, legal tech, e-commerce and logistics technology. It’s also a major hiring center for tech companies on both coasts.

Key Facts About Chicago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 245,800; 5.2%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: McDonald’s, John Deere, Boeing, Morningstar
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, biotechnology, fintech, software, logistics technology
  • Funding Landscape: $2.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Pritzker Group Venture Capital, Arch Venture Partners, MATH Venture Partners, Jump Capital, Hyde Park Venture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: Northwestern University, University of Chicago, University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ign, Illinois Institute of Technology, Argonne National Laboratory, Fermi National Accelerator Laboratory
